How to Choose the Best Brokers

  • Obviously, the best forex market brokers will depend on your goals, what you hope to achieve. At a minimum, the broker should be well-regulated in your country and by the top-tier regulators to safeguard against malpractices. Research the broker and identify any complaints against them. If they have been fined in the past for malpractice, it’s best to look elsewhere.
  • The best forex broker for beginners should easily add funds and make withdrawals. Most platforms will show the time and method of making withdrawals on their website. Check this and compare with others, and choose the one that fits your needs most.  Check how much the brokers will charge you for withdrawals. Some of them will charge you zero fees on deposits but exorbitantly on withdrawals.
  • Track the fees that brokers charge through commission on trades, spreads, and rollover. Some brokers will charge extra for withdrawals and deposits, sometimes in the background. 
  • Order execution speed is critical in forex trading to avoid requotes and slippage. If you open and close a handful of positions daily, a forex trader with the best execution speed will come in handy. The best way to test a trader’s execution speed is to sign up for an account and place trades on the live platform. Some brokers will have different speeds on the live platform and the demo account. For some, the demo account is not the best representation of the live account. Sign on a low position and minimum funding and test the live account directly.
  • It also helps if the trader has multi-device platforms. Most of the traders have a mobile and desktop app which makes trading convenient. If your preference is mobile trading, find out if the trader has an android version or the iOS version. Other great features that you should look out for include newsfeeds, alerts, and lightning-fast pick and close trades.

FAQs

How do online forex brokers work?

The main work of online forex brokers is buying and selling currencies on behalf of the client. They are an independent entity that organizes and execute transactions across different asset classes on your behalf, and of course, at a commission.

How do online forex brokers make money?

Some forex brokers make money through the bid/ask prices charges, and others through commissions from every trade. The primary way for most of them is through a set fee per round turn and keeping the spread. Some scrupulous forex brokers will have hidden charges after saying they have commission-free trades.
